Becoming Your Best: A Teacher’s Guide to Excellence in the Classroom is an empowering, practical guide for educators seeking to elevate their teaching practice and create transformative learning experiences. Rooted in Carol Dweck’s growth mindset, this book offers a roadmap for continuous improvement, helping teachers at all career stages cultivate resilience, purpose, and inclusivity. Through six insightful chapters, it explores cultivating an adaptive mindset, defining your core teaching purpose, understanding diverse student needs, fostering equitable classrooms, building personal resilience, and synthesizing a personalized teaching philosophy. Packed with reflective prompts, actionable strategies, and real-world examples, this guide equips educators to navigate challenges, engage every learner, and sustain passion for teaching. Whether you’re a new teacher or a seasoned educator, Becoming Your Best inspires you to create classrooms where students thrive as critical thinkers and empowered individuals, while fostering your own growth and fulfillment.
